Troubleshooting: Postman Pre-Request Script Fails with TypeError (Cannot Read Properties of Undefined)

    Overview

    When using the Postman collections provided by SecureAuth to call the SecureAuth API, a GET request can fail with the following error:

    There was an error in evaluating the Pre-request Script:TypeError: Cannot read properties of undefined (reading 'length')

     

    Cause

    The active Postman environment is missing one or more variables that the pre-request script expects — for example, AppID or AppKey

    Resolution:

    Check the active Postman environment for missing variables. If the environment was recently modified, confirm a variable wasn't accidentally removed that the pre-request script still needs.
